What Should You Consider When Choosing a Car Battery?

Warranty: A comprehensive warranty reflects the manufacturer’s confidence in their product. Warranties can vary greatly, with some lasting only a year while others can extend to 5 years or more. A longer warranty may indicate a more reliable battery, providing you with assurance against early failure.

Size and Fit: Each vehicle requires a specific size of battery to function properly. Installing a battery that doesn’t fit can cause damage to the vehicle’s electrical system or lead to poor performance. Always refer to your vehicle’s owner’s manual or consult with a professional to ensure the correct battery size is chosen.

Maintenance Requirements: While some batteries are maintenance-free, others may require regular checks, such as topping up water levels and cleaning terminals. Understanding the maintenance needs of your chosen battery can help you avoid unexpected failures and extend its lifespan. Maintenance-free options are often preferred for their convenience.

What Are the Advantages of AGM Batteries Over Lead-Acid Batteries?

The advantages of AGM batteries over traditional lead-acid batteries include several key features that enhance their performance and usability.

  • Higher Energy Density: AGM batteries have a higher energy density compared to lead-acid batteries, allowing them to store more energy in a smaller, lighter package. This makes them particularly advantageous for applications where space and weight are critical, such as in automotive and marine settings.
  • Better Deep Cycle Performance: AGM batteries are designed to handle deep discharges better than conventional lead-acid batteries. They can be discharged to a lower state of charge without significant damage, making them ideal for applications that require frequent deep cycling, like electric vehicles and renewable energy systems.
  • Low Self-Discharge Rate: AGM batteries exhibit a lower self-discharge rate than lead-acid batteries, which allows them to retain their charge for a longer period of time when not in use. This feature is particularly beneficial for seasonal vehicles or equipment that may sit idle for extended periods.
  • Vibration Resistance: AGM batteries are built to withstand vibrations and shocks better than traditional lead-acid batteries. This makes them suitable for use in rugged environments, such as off-road vehicles or heavy machinery, where durability is essential.
  • Maintenance-Free: AGM batteries are sealed and do not require regular maintenance, such as checking or topping off the electrolyte levels. This convenience makes them easier to use for individuals who may not have the time or expertise to maintain traditional lead-acid batteries.
  • Safer Operation: AGM batteries minimize the risk of acid spills and gas emissions, which can pose safety hazards. Their sealed construction makes them safer to operate in enclosed spaces and reduces the risk of lead contamination, making them more environmentally friendly.
  • Faster Recharge Time: AGM batteries can be recharged more quickly than lead-acid batteries, allowing for reduced downtime in applications where battery performance is critical. This feature is particularly useful in automotive and commercial settings where efficiency is a priority.

What Factors Contribute to the Lifespan of Car Batteries?

The lifespan of car batteries is influenced by several key factors:

  • Temperature: Extreme temperatures can significantly affect battery performance and lifespan. High temperatures can cause the battery fluid to evaporate, while cold temperatures can reduce its capacity to hold a charge.
  • Charging Practices: Proper charging is essential for maximizing battery life. Overcharging can lead to excessive heat and damage, while undercharging can cause sulfation, which reduces the battery’s ability to hold a charge over time.
  • Usage Patterns: Frequent short trips can prevent a battery from fully charging, leading to a shorter lifespan. In contrast, regular long drives allow the battery to recharge fully and maintain its health.
  • Maintenance: Regular maintenance, such as cleaning terminals and ensuring proper fluid levels, can extend battery life. Corroded connections can impede performance and lead to premature failure.
  • Battery Quality: The quality of the battery itself plays a crucial role; higher quality batteries often have better materials and construction, leading to longer lifespans. Investing in reputable brands can provide better durability and warranties.
  • Electrical Load: The number and type of electrical components in a vehicle can impact battery life. Vehicles with more electronics, like advanced infotainment systems and additional lighting, may draw more power and require a higher capacity battery.

What Do Consumers Say About Common Car Battery Issues?

Consumers often share their experiences regarding common car battery issues, highlighting specific problems and factors that influence their satisfaction.

  • Battery Lifespan: Many consumers express their concerns about the lifespan of car batteries, often expecting them to last at least three to five years. Reviews frequently mention that extreme weather conditions, such as excessive heat or cold, can significantly shorten a battery’s lifespan, leading to premature failure.
  • Starting Power: One of the most common complaints revolves around the battery’s ability to start the engine, particularly in cold weather. Consumers often review batteries based on their cold cranking amps (CCA), which indicates how well the battery can perform in low temperatures, with higher CCA ratings generally being more favorable.
  • Charging Issues: Issues with batteries not holding a charge or failing to recharge properly are frequently highlighted. Reviewers note that these problems can stem from either the battery itself or faulty alternators, leading to confusion regarding whether the battery or the vehicle’s electrical system is at fault.
  • Warranty and Customer Service: Many consumers emphasize the importance of a good warranty when selecting a car battery. Positive reviews often mention responsive customer service and hassle-free warranty claims, which can greatly enhance consumer confidence in the product.
  • Price vs. Performance: Reviews often discuss the balance between price and performance, with some consumers willing to pay a premium for a battery that offers superior reliability and longevity. Conversely, others report satisfaction with budget-friendly options that deliver adequate performance for everyday use.
